Side-by-side comparison
| Attribute | Mem | TickTick AI |
|---|---|---|
| Vendor | Mem Labs | TickTick |
| Rating | ★ 4 | ★ 4.5 |
| Pricing | Freemium | Freemium |
| Platforms | Web, iOS | Web, Desktop, Mobile |
| Key features | Self-organizing notes, AI writing and drafting, Automatic related-note surfacing | NL parse, Calendar plus tasks, Habits |
| Headquarters | San Francisco, USA | San Francisco, USA |
| Founded | 2019 | 2024 |
| Open source | No | No |
